For some reason, I thought this band had gone on to release a full-length somewhere. But I can’t find evidence of that, so I guess I dreamed it up. Anyways, this is an extreme metal band. The first song has a bit a of a doom intro before jumping into a death/thrash groove. Some sources have said this band is a mix of Pantera and Mortification, and I see where they say that. I would say Paramaecium instead, but that might just be me. This definitely came out when thrash, death, doom, crossover, and hardcore were mixing together. The second song does have a noticeable death metal intro with some doom elements, before breaking out in a Pantera-esque groove (with death metal growls combined with hardcore shouts over it). After this tape, the band released the 3-song Owe You Nothing demo in 1996. Also note that this is not the same Purge that had the song “Hate Crimes” on an HM sampler in 2000.
